php一覧

NO IMAGE

[_s] template-tags.php

template-tags.php テンプレートファイルで使うタグを定義しています。全ての関数がif ( ! function_exists())でラップされており、 子テーマのfunctions.phpで定義することで上書きが可能になっています。(基本的には、 子テーマ...

NO IMAGE

[_s] template-functions.php

template-functions.php どのような関数をまとめておくためのファイルなのか、ファイルの名前からわかりにくいですが、テンプレートファイルのhtmlやcssに直接変更を加えるような関数をまとめるためのファイルだそうです。もとはextra.phpというどこに...

NO IMAGE

[_s] jetpack.php

jetpackプラグイン jetpackとは_sを提供しているAutomatitcのプラグインで、WordPressに様々な機能を提供してくれます。機能が多すぎて逆によくわからないぐらいの機能があります。 Jetpackの公式サイト jetpackが提供してい...

NO IMAGE

[_s] customizer.php

customizer画面 customizerとは、管理画面の外観 > カスタマイズから利用できる画面で、WordPressの直感的な変更が可能になります。 この customizerという仕組みがどう動いているのか、以下が一番わかりやすかったです。ただ、処理...

NO IMAGE

[_s] custom-header.php

custom-header.php カスタムヘッダーを有効にすると、管理画面の外観 > カスタマイズでヘッダー部分を変更できるようになります。_sでは、custom-header.phpという別ファイルに記述されて、functions.phpからrequireされています...

NO IMAGE

[_s] functions.phpの構成

WordPressのfunctions.phpは、テーマの中で共通して使われる関数をまとめたファイルです。 テンプレートファイルとは役割が異なり、その名前の通りテーマに色々な機能を与えるために使われます。 _sでは、functions.php、またfunctions.p...

NO IMAGE

[_s] sidebar.php

sidebar.php sidebar.phpは、サイドバーを表示するためのテンプレートパートファイルです。テンプレートファイルから、get_sidebar()関数を使って読み込まれます。 また、functions.php の register_sidebar()...

NO IMAGE

[_s] footer.php

footer.php footer.phpは、_sのテンプレートパートファイルで、フッター部分を担当します。全てのテンプレートファイルから、get_footer()関数を使って読み込まれます。 ただし、header.phpと同様に、厳密にはfooterだけではなく、...